What is Splash9 Autonomous Surface Vessels?

Splash9 Autonomous Surface Vessels preview

Splash9 develops cutting-edge autonomous surface vessels (ASVs) that provide advanced maritime security and operational capabilities. These unmanned patrol boats are engineered to secure national borders, protect critical infrastructure such as oil rigs and ports, and support naval operations with full autonomy. Equipped with state-of-the-art sensors and AI-driven algorithms, Splash9 vessels can operate independently in communication-denied environments, perform multi-mission tasks, and deploy various payloads for specialized missions. Their modular design and robust endurance enable applications ranging from coastal patrols to commercial inspection and payload delivery.


Key Features

  • Full Autonomy

    Advanced AI and sensor fusion enable vessels to execute complex missions without human input, even in communication-denied areas.

  • High Performance

    Top speeds up to 50 knots and operational range of 800 miles allow rapid response and extended maritime presence.

  • Modular Payload Capacity

    Customizable payload bays support diverse equipment such as side-scan sonars, UAVs, and other mission-specific sensors.

  • Scalable Fleet Management

    Integrated tech stack allows a single operator to deploy and command fleets of autonomous vessels efficiently.

  • Multi-Mission Capability

    Designed for coastal patrol, infrastructure security, naval operations, and commercial tasks like bathymetric surveys and cargo delivery.


Use Cases

  • National Security and Border Patrol : Autonomous vessels patrol maritime borders to detect and intercept threats such as narcotics smuggling and unauthorized vessels.
  • Critical Infrastructure Protection : Secure oil rigs, ports, and military bases by autonomously enforcing restricted zones and responding to suspicious activity.
  • Naval Support Operations : Assist naval missions with autonomous decision-making and payload deployment in complex and communication-denied environments.
  • Commercial Maritime Applications : Automate tasks like seabed mapping, offshore cargo delivery, and wind turbine inspections with adaptable vessel configurations.
